Thanks to the drought, these black-and-white beauties are struggling to catch worms in the rock-hard earth. But there's still good foraging on well-watered fairways and greens
Name: Badgers.
Age: European badgers live for five to eight years in the wild. They have been in the UK, where this story is set, for half to three-quarters of a million years.
